Stuart won the last time they faced Hampton, and things went their way on Friday too. The Stuart Broncos breezed by the Hampton Hawks on the road to the tune of 57-6. With the Broncos ahead 36-0 at the half, the contest was all but over already.
Multiple players turned in solid performances to lead Stuart to victory, but perhaps none more so than Kayde Ramm, who threw for 146 yards and five touchdowns on only 13 passes. Ramm also deserves a shoutout for his performance on D, picking up a sack and making four total tackles. Owen Littau was another key player, rushing for 87 yards and two touchdowns.
Despite the loss, Hampton still got an impressive performance from Jack Bullis, who rushed for 85 yards and a touchdown on only ten carries. Bullis got the majority of those rushing yards when he took off on a run that went for an incredible 57 yards.
Stuart pushed their record up to 5-1 with the victory, which was their eighth straight on the road dating back to last season. As for Hampton, their loss dropped their record down to 4-2.
